I haven't heard the press conference yet, but the Walesonline says:
"There are a couple of little knocks. Chris Willock has taken a knock on his ankle and probably won't be available. Callum Robinson has had a little tweak in his calf so potentially won't be available. Other than that, everyone else is back." (Riza)
It is also understood that Joe Ralls is unlikely to feature this weekend. Meanwhile, it was confirmed during the international break that Aaron Ramsey's season is over after undergoing surgery on a fresh hamstring injury.
